From 1c32dff7d6b4cf00d1e63ac79968e9deb8b90e2e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Bram Moolenaar Date: Thu, 5 May 2011 16:41:24 +0200 Subject: updated for version 7.3.172 Problem: MS-Windows: rename() might delete the file if the name differs but it's actually the same file. Solution: Use the file handle to check if it's the same file.
